From mboxrd@z Thu Jan 1 00:00:00 1970 From: bugme-daemon@bugzilla.kernel.org Subject: [Bug 11630] New: SIS 5513 pata_sis exception Date: Tue, 23 Sep 2008 15:59:44 -0700 (PDT) Message-ID: Return-path: Received: from smtp1.linux-foundation.org ([140.211.169.13]:50784 "EHLO smtp1.linux-found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752988AbYIWXAQ (ORCPT ); Tue, 23 Sep 2008 19:00:16 -0400 Received: from picon.linux-foundation.org (picon.linux-foundation.org [140.211.169.79]) by smtp1.linux-foundation.org (8.14.2/8.13.5/Debian-3ubuntu1.1) with ESMTP id m8NMxiNd028362 for ; Tue, 23 Sep 2008 15:59:45 -0700 Sender: linux-ide-owner@vger.kernel.org List-Id: linux-ide@vger.kernel.org To: linux-ide@vger.kernel.org http://bugzilla.kernel.org/show_bug.cgi?id=11630 Summary: SIS 5513 pata_sis exception Product: IO/Storage Version: 2.5 KernelVersion: 2.6.27-rc6 2.6.27-rc5-mm1 Platform: All OS/Version: Linux Tree: Mainline Status: NEW Severity: normal Priority: P1 Component: IDE AssignedTo: io_ide@kernel-bugs.osdl.org ReportedBy: tomasz89@gmail.com Latest working kernel version: None. Earliest failing kernel version: 2.6.17-10 (Ubuntu) Distribution: Ubuntu 8.04 Hardware Environment: (A horrible) PCChips M748LMRT (SiS 620 chipset). The IDE controller is a SiS 5513. Below is the lspci -vvv output: 00:00.0 Host bridge: Silicon Integrated Systems [SiS] 620 Host (rev 02)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- SERR- 00:00.1 IDE interface: Silicon Integrated Systems [SiS] 5513 [IDE] (rev d0) (prog-if 80 [Master]) Subsystem: Silicon Integrated Systems [SiS] SiS5513 EIDE Controller (A,B step)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- Status: Cap- 66MHz- UDF- FastB2B- ParErr- DEVSEL=fast >TAbort- SERR- TAbort- SERR- TAbort- SERR- TAbort- SERR- TAbort- SERR- TAbort- Reset- FastB2B- 00:09.0 RAID bus controller: Silicon Image, Inc. SiI 0649 Ultra ATA/100 PCI to ATA Host Controller (rev 02) Subsystem: Silicon Image, Inc. SiI 0649 Ultra ATA/100 PCI to ATA Host Controller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R+ FastB2B- Status: Cap+ 66MHz- U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- SERR- 00:0f.0 Multimedia audio controller: C-Media Electronics Inc CM8738 (rev 10) Subsystem: C-Media Electronics Inc CMI8738/C3DX PCI Audio Device Control: I/O+ Mem- B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R+ FastB2B-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- SERR- 00:0f.1 Communication controller: C-Media Electronics Inc CM8738 (rev 10) Subsystem: C-Media Electronics Inc CM8738 Control: I/O+ Mem- BusMaster- S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- SERR- 00:10.0 Ethernet controller: Silicon Integrated Systems [SiS] SiS900 PCI Fast Ethernet (rev 02) Subsystem: Silicon Integrated Systems [SiS] SiS900 10/100 Ethernet Adapter onboard [Asus P4SC-EA]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R+ FastB2B- Status: Cap+ 66MHz- U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- SERR- 01:00.0 VGA compatible controller: Silicon Integrated Systems [SiS] 530/620 PCI/AGP VGA Display Adapter (rev 2a) (prog-if 00 [VGA controller]) Subsystem: Silicon Integrated Systems [SiS] SiS530,620 GUI Accelerator+3D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- Status: Cap+ 66MHz+ U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- SERR- Software Environment: This is a fairly minimal cut down install, as I am only trying to reproduce the problem. Problem Description: The pata_sis module causes all kinds of issues when in use and going through this layer to access the HDD and CDROM results in the output below. Interestingly however the older IDE layer driver "sis5513" works perfectly. 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 82 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/33 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 82 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/33 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 82 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/33 ata4: EH complete ata4.00: limiting speed to UDMA/25:PIO4 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 82 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/25 sr 3:0:0:0: [sr0] Result: hostbyte=0x00 driverbyte=0x08 sr 3:0:0:0: [sr0] Sense Key : 0xb [current] [descriptor] Descriptor sense data with sense descriptors (in hex): 72 0b 00 00 00 00 00 0e 09 0c 00 00 00 02 00 00 00 08 00 00 a0 40 sr 3:0:0:0: [sr0] ASC=0x0 ASCQ=0x0 end_request: I/O error, dev sr0, sector 614920 Buffer I/O error on device sr0, logical block 76865 Buffer I/O error on device sr0, logical block 76866 Buffer I/O error on device sr0, logical block 76867 Buffer I/O error on device sr0, logical block 76868 Buffer I/O error on device sr0, logical block 76869 Buffer I/O error on device sr0, logical block 76870 Buffer I/O error on device sr0, logical block 76871 Buffer I/O error on device sr0, logical block 76872 Buffer I/O error on device sr0, logical block 76873 Buffer I/O error on device sr0, logical block 76874 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 c2 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/25 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 c2 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/25 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 c2 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: configured for UDMA/25 ata4: EH complete ata4.00: exception Emask 0x0 SAct 0x0 SErr 0x0 action 0x6 frozen ata4.00: cmd a0/01:00:00:00:fc/00:00:00:00:00/a0 tag 0 dma 126976 in cdb 28 00 00 02 58 c2 00 00 3e 00 00 00 00 00 00 00 res 40/00:02:00:08:00/00:00:00:00:00/a0 Emask 0x4 (timeout) ata4.00: status: { DRDY } ata4: link is slow to respond, please be patient (ready=0) ata4: device not ready (errno=-16), forcing hardreset ata4: soft resetting link ata4.00: failed to IDENTIFY (I/O error, err_mask=0x2) ata4.00: revalidation failed (errno=-5) ata4: soft resetting link ata4.00: configured for UDMA/25 sr 3:0:0:0: [sr0] Result: hostbyte=0x00 driverbyte=0x08 sr 3:0:0:0: [sr0] Sense Key : 0xb [current] [descriptor] Descriptor sense data with sense descriptors (in hex): 72 0b 00 00 00 00 00 0e 09 0c 00 00 00 02 00 00 00 08 00 00 a0 40 sr 3:0:0:0: [sr0] ASC=0x0 ASCQ=0x0 end_request: I/O error, dev sr0, sector 615176 __ratelimit: 21 callbacks suppressed Buffer I/O error on device sr0, logical block 76897 Buffer I/O error on device sr0, logical block 76898 Buffer I/O error on device sr0, logical block 76899 Buffer I/O error on device sr0, logical block 76900 Buffer I/O error on device sr0, logical block 76901 Buffer I/O error on device sr0, logical block 76902 Buffer I/O error on device sr0, logical block 76903 Buffer I/O error on device sr0, logical block 76904 Buffer I/O error on device sr0, logical block 76905 Buffer I/O error on device sr0, logical block 76906 ata4: EH complete Steps to reproduce: Any modern distro will no doubt favour the newly developed pata drivers over the older ide layer where available, so trying to boot off for example an Ubuntu Hardy live CD will generate these errors from either the CDROM or HDD as it uses the new PATA layer to access the underlying devices. --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are the assignee for the bug, or are watching the assignee.